    University of Warwick Staff and Students

    You automatically become a member of the Library when you start your course or your appointment. Your University card is also your Library card. You will need this to get into the Library and to borrow books. To avoid creating delays at the Entrance Gates please remember to bring your card.

    Issuing Students Reference Passes is time consuming and creates queues at the entrance. Currently students can be issued with a maximum of 3 passes per term. An administration fee of £1 will be added to student accounts for the 3rd and any subsequent pass issued in a term and vacation period.

    Prospective University of Warwick Students

    Prospective students may join the Library as external borrowers before their course begins. Prospective Postgraduate students can apply for membership from 1st July each year and Prospective Undergraduate students from 1st September. An external borrower may borrow up to 5 items at any one time. Items from our Short Loan Collection are not available for loan using an external borrower card. The card will be valid from the date of issue until the end of the first week of the Autumn term when a student card should have been issued. Reference-only Membership is permitted if you wish to use the Library before the set date.

    You may apply for membership providing you show photographic proof of your identity i.e. passport, driving licence; a recent utility bill or bank/credit card statement to confirm your current address and a letter confirming your offer of a place on a University of Warwick Postgraduate or Undergraduate course. An application form will need to be completed for the registration to be processed.

    Staff and Students from Other Universities

    Warwick University is a member of the SCONUL Access scheme which allows users from other universities and colleges to access the Library. Please contact your own institution for details of how to join.

    Staff, Research students, Full-time and Part-time Postgraduates, Distance Learning and Placement students from participating institutions may borrow up to 5 items at any one time. Items from our Short Loan Collection are not available for borrowing by visitors.

    Full-time Undergraduates from other universities and colleges are not entitled to borrowing privileges within the SCONUL Access scheme and have reference-only access to the Library.

    Access to E-resources, where licences permit, is provided on the single PC reserved for this purpose on Floor 1 of the University Library, to registered users visiting the University Library in person. For a list of resources that are accessible to view only http://www2.warwick.ac.uk/services/library/basics/accessmembership/walkinresources

    To access the Library please call at the Welcome Desk and complete a registration form. Please bring your SCONUL Access card, your current student card as photographic proof of your identity and a recent utility bill or bank/credit card statement to confirm your current address. A passport sized image with your name clearly printed on the reverse is also required for use on your membership card if you are entitled to borrowing privileges. An electronic image is acceptable - please send to lib.membership@warwick.ac.uk.

    Members of the Public

    Members of the public may have access to the Library for reference use only with a day pass providing they call at the Library Welcome Desk and show photographic proof of their identity i.e. passport, driving licence and a recent utility bill or bank/credit card statement to confirm their current address. A day visitor pass gives reference access to the Library for the day of issue. Day visitor passes are issued during staffed service hours only.

    You may apply for reference-only membership of the University Library free of charge providing you show photographic proof of your identity i.e. passport, driving licence and a recent utility bill or bank/credit card statement to confirm your current address. An application form will need to be completed for the registration to be processed.

    Reference-only Membership allows unlimited access to the University Library Monday to Sunday 8.30am to 9.30pm. Access to printed materials on the open shelves and copying facilities using re-chargeable photocopy cards that can be purchased in the Photocopy area on Floor 1. Charges are displayed in the Photocopying area.

    External Borrowers

    Members of the public may request individual external borrowers' membership.

    See Borrowing Items for information on loan entitlement.

    Access to E-resources, where licences permit, is provided on the single PC reserved for this purpose on Floor 1 of the University Library, to registered users visiting the University Library in person. For a list of resources that are accessible to view only http://www2.warwick.ac.uk/services/library/basics/accessmembership/walkinresources

    All applicants must call at the Library Welcome Desk and meet the following conditions:

    • Complete an application form
    • Pay an annual fee of £85 plus VAT for 12 months (£102.00) or £60 plus VAT for 6 months (£72.00). On registering, provide photographic proof of ID i.e. passport, driving licence and a recent utility bill or bank/credit card statement as confirmation of a current address. A passport sized image with the applicant's name clearly printed on the reverse is also required for use on the Library membership card (an electronic image is acceptable - please send to lib.membership@warwick.ac.uk).
    • Agree to abide by the Library Rules and Regulations

    A plastic card will be issued to all external borrowers and lost/stolen cards must be reported to the Library immediately. A charge of £15 will be made for a replacement to be printed.
